The Witcher Movie From The Mummy Producer is Coming in 2017


With Blizzard getting a Warcraft film, Ubisoft getting an Assassin's Creed film, it's no surprise that other videogame companies are starting to jump behind videogame films again.

A full-length film based on Andrzej Sapkowski's The Witcher series is being developed and is slated to arrive in 2017. American film production company and producers of The Mummy series, The Sean Daniel Company, has announced that it will work with Polish company Platige Films on the film.

Platige produced the amazing Witcher 3 trailer called "The Trail" and also created cinematics for Halo 5: Guardians, among other projects.

According to the press release, the producers said the film will star Geralt of Rivia, but won't be a straight adaptation of any of the novels or games. Instead, it will follow the "themes" of the short stories The Witcher and Lesser Evil from Sapkowski's The Last Wishcollection. The film is expected to be the first in a series.
